Even though most of the Earth's surface is water, only 1% of it is fresh usable water. Ninety-seven per cent of the Earth's water is saltwater, which contains too many minerals for humans to use untreated.
Two per cent of our water is 'locked up' in ice caps and glaciers, leaving only one per cent as usable freshwater. Groundwater comprises 0.62 per cent of water, followed by Freshwater Lakes: 0.009 per cent; and rivers: 0.0001 per cent.
